Safety Information

To ensure safe operation and prevent damage, please observe the following safety precautions:

  • Do not expose the monitor to rain or moisture to prevent fire or electric shock.
  • Do not open the monitor casing. There are no user-serviceable parts inside. Refer all servicing to qualified personnel.
  • Place the monitor on a stable, flat surface to prevent it from falling.
  • Ensure proper ventilation around the monitor. Do not block ventilation openings.
  • Use only the power adapter supplied with the monitor.
  • Disconnect the power cable during lightning storms or when unused for long periods.
  • Avoid placing heavy objects on the power cord.
  • Keep the monitor away from direct sunlight, heat sources, and extreme temperatures.

Setup

1. Assembling the Stand

Attach the stand base to the stand neck, then secure the assembled stand to the back of the monitor. Ensure all screws are tightened securely.

2. Connecting Cables

Connect the provided HDMI cable from your computer's graphics card to the HDMI 2.0 port on the monitor. For power, connect the power adapter to the DC input port on the monitor, then plug the adapter into a power outlet.

The monitor also features a DisplayPort 1.4 for alternative video input and a 3.5mm audio output for external speakers or headphones.

3. Initial Power On

Press the power button located on the back of the monitor to turn it on. The monitor will automatically detect the active input source. If no signal is detected, ensure your computer is powered on and the video cable is securely connected.

Operating Instructions

1. Power On/Off

Press the joystick button (power button) on the back of the monitor to turn it on. Press and hold the joystick button for a few seconds to turn it off.

2. OSD Menu Navigation

The monitor's On-Screen Display (OSD) menu is controlled using the joystick button on the back.

  • Push the joystick button: Enters the OSD menu or confirms a selection.
  • Move joystick Up/Down: Navigates through menu options or adjusts brightness/volume.
  • Move joystick Left/Right: Navigates through menu options or adjusts contrast/input source.

3. Adjusting Display Settings

Access the OSD menu to adjust various display settings:

  • Brightness/Contrast: Adjust these settings to your preference for optimal viewing.
  • Color Settings: Modify color temperature, gamma, and other color-related parameters.
  • Picture Mode: Select from predefined modes (e.g., Standard, Game, Movie) or customize your own.
  • Input Source: Manually select between HDMI and DisplayPort inputs if auto-detection fails.
  • Refresh Rate: Ensure your graphics card settings match the monitor's 200Hz refresh rate for the smoothest experience.
  • FreeSync: Enable FreeSync in the OSD menu and your graphics card control panel for tear-free gaming.

4. Audio Output

The monitor includes built-in speakers. You can also connect external speakers or headphones to the 3.5mm audio output port for enhanced audio.

Key Features

1. Immersive Curved Display

The Minifire MFG27C1 features a 27-inch VA panel with a 1500R curvature, designed to provide an immersive viewing experience, especially for gaming. This curvature helps reduce eye strain and enhances peripheral vision.

2. High Refresh Rate and Fast Response Time

Experience smooth, fluid visuals with a 200Hz refresh rate and a rapid 1ms (MPRT) response time. This combination minimizes motion blur and ghosting, crucial for fast-paced gaming.

3. Vibrant Color Reproduction

The VA panel offers a 130% sRGB color gamut, delivering rich, accurate colors and deep blacks for a high contrast ratio (2000:1). This enhances visual fidelity for both gaming and multimedia content.

4. AMD FreeSync Technology

With AMD FreeSync technology, the monitor synchronizes its refresh rate with your graphics card's frame rate, eliminating screen tearing and stuttering for a smoother gaming experience.

Maintenance

Cleaning the Monitor

To clean the monitor screen, gently wipe it with a soft, lint-free cloth. For stubborn marks, dampen the cloth slightly with water or a non-abrasive screen cleaner. Do not spray cleaner directly onto the screen.

For the monitor casing, use a soft, dry c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ials.

Storage

If storing the monitor for an extended period, disconnect all cables and pack it in its original packaging if possible.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.

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your Minifire MFG27C1 monitor, refer to the following common problems and solutions:

No Power

  • Ensure the power cable is securely connected to both the monitor and a working power outlet.
  • Verify the power adapter is functioning correctly.
  • Press the power button firmly.

No Signal

  • Check that the HDMI or DisplayPort cable is securely connected to both the monitor and your computer.
  • Ensure your computer is powered on and not in sleep mode.
  • Select the correct input source using the OSD menu.
  • Try a different video cable or port if available.

Image Flickering or Tearing

  • Ensure AMD FreeSync is enabled in both the monitor's OSD menu and your graphics card settings.
  • Verify that your graphics card drivers are up to date.
  • Check the refresh rate setting in your operating system's display settings; it should be set to 200Hz.

No Sound from Built-in Speakers

  • Check the volume level in the monitor's OSD menu and your computer's sound settings.
  • Ensure the correct audio output device is selected in your computer's sound settings.
  • If using HDMI/DisplayPort, ensure your graphics card is sending audio.
  • If using the 3.5mm audio output, ensure external speakers/headphones are properly connected and powered.

Buttons Not Responding

  • Unplug the monitor's power cable, wait 30 seconds, then plug it back in to reset the monitor.
  • Ensure no objects are obstructing the buttons.

Specifications

FeatureSpecification
BrandMinifire
Model NumberMFG27C1-200
Screen Size27 Inches
ResolutionFHD 1080p (1920 x 1080)
Aspect Ratio16:9
Panel TypeVA
Screen SurfaceMatte
Curvature1500R
Refresh Rate200 Hz
Response Time1 millisecond (MPRT)
Contrast Ratio2000:1
Color Gamut Value130% sRGB
Adaptive Sync TechnologyFreeSync
ConnectivityHDMI 2.0 (up to 200 Hz), DisplayPort 1.4 (up to 200 Hz), 3.5mm Audio Output
Built-in SpeakersYes
Power Voltage240 Volts
Item Dimensions (D x W x H)68.5 x 43.5 x 12.6 centimeters
Item Weight3.3 Kilograms
ColorBlack
